The Cost Breakdown of Private Psychiatry
The cost of speaking with a private psychiatrist can vary widely based upon numerous elements, consisting of the psychiatrist's experience, location, type of service supplied, and session length. Factors Influencing Costs
Experience and Qualifications:
Psychiatrists with more years of practice and advanced qualifications frequently charge higher charges.
Location:
Costs can substantially differ in between urban and backwoods. Significant cities like London normally have higher overhead, causing more costly assessments.
Type of Service:
Initial assessments tend to be more costly than follow-up sessions. Specialized treatments (e.g., psychotherapy combined with medication management) may also incur higher expenses.
Session Duration:
Standard sessions frequently last about 50-60 minutes, but longer sessions can lead to increased fees.
Private Health Insurance:
If covered by private medical insurance, patients might just be accountable for a copayment or deductible, potentially lowering the out-of-pocket expenditure.Typical Costs

Is it worth paying for a private psychiatrist?
The choice to see a private psychiatrist often depends upon specific circumstances, consisting of seriousness, spending plan, and the desire for personalized care. For those who can afford it, the quicker access and tailored treatment may validate the costs.
2. Does insurance coverage cover private psychiatric services?
Many private health insurance policies cover some expenses connected to psychiatric services. It's recommended to inspect your policy details for specific coverage information and to comprehend any constraints or exemptions.

5. Exist options to seeing a psychiatrist?
Yes, options can consist of talking to a medical psychologist or licensed therapist who might provide psychiatric therapy without needing medication, depending on the individual's particular needs.
